Calculate the real cost to run your JS app or lib to keep good performance. Show error in pull request if the cost exceeds the limit.
β6,891Mar 6, 2026Updated 2 weeks ago
Alternatives and similar repositories for size-limit
Users that are interested in size-limit are comparing it to the libraries listed below
Sorting:
- Keep your bundle size in checkβ4,484Jan 15, 2025Updated last year
- π¦ Zero-configuration bundler for tiny modules.β8,142Feb 1, 2026Updated last month
- A tiny (118 bytes), secure, URL-friendly, unique string ID generator for JavaScriptβ26,676Mar 15, 2026Updated last week
- A better `npm publish`β7,686Jan 29, 2026Updated last month
- ESM-powered frontend build tool. Instant, lightweight, unbundled development. βοΈβ19,372Mar 5, 2023Updated 3 years ago
- An extremely fast bundler for the webβ39,853Mar 12, 2026Updated last week
- Zero-runtime CSS in JS libraryβ12,290Feb 7, 2026Updated last month
- Zero-config CLI for TypeScript package developmentβ11,460Feb 9, 2026Updated last month
- ποΈ Find out the cost of adding a new frontend dependency to your projectβ9,470Mar 8, 2026Updated 2 weeks ago
- Industry standard API mocking for JavaScript.β17,748Updated this week
- Hyperscript Tagged Markup: JSX alternative using standard tagged templates, with compiler support.β9,010Feb 1, 2024Updated 2 years ago
- Lerna is a fast, modern build system for managing and publishing multiple JavaScript/TypeScript packages from the same repository.β36,090Updated this week
- π React for interactive command-line appsβ35,620Mar 11, 2026Updated last week
- Actor-based state management & orchestration for complex app logic.β29,345Mar 15, 2026Updated last week
- π© A tiny (185 bytes) event-based Redux-like state manager for React, Preact, Angular, Vue, and Svelteβ1,978Dec 10, 2024Updated last year
- β³ Modern JavaScript date utility library βοΈβ36,523Sep 8, 2025Updated 6 months ago
- Unified developer tools for JavaScript, TypeScript, and the webβ23,488Sep 4, 2023Updated 2 years ago
- Comlink makes WebWorkers enjoyable.β12,598Feb 26, 2026Updated 3 weeks ago
- Git hooks made easy πΆ woof!β34,879Mar 16, 2026Updated last week
- π«π© β Run tasks like formatters and linters against staged git filesβ14,511Mar 15, 2026Updated last week
- Super-fast alternative to Babel for when you can target modern JS runtimesβ5,859Nov 19, 2025Updated 4 months ago
- Rust-based platform for the Webβ33,314Updated this week
- Node.js test runner that lets you develop with confidence πβ20,855Mar 3, 2026Updated 2 weeks ago
- β€οΈ JavaScript/TypeScript linter (ESLint wrapper) with great defaultsβ7,964Mar 14, 2026Updated last week
- Next-generation ES module bundlerβ26,256Mar 13, 2026Updated last week
- π Bare minimum 500b fetch polyfill.β5,722Jul 23, 2023Updated 2 years ago
- The simplest and fastest way to bundle your TypeScript libraries.β11,164Feb 28, 2026Updated 3 weeks ago
- A collection of essential TypeScript typesβ16,974Mar 15, 2026Updated last week
- β οΈ Stop saying "you forgot to β¦" in code reviewβ5,459Mar 13, 2026Updated last week
- π©βπ€ CSS-in-JS library designed for high performance style compositionβ18,007Nov 4, 2025Updated 4 months ago
- A JavaScript codemod toolkit.β9,965Updated this week
- π A set of primitives to build simple, flexible, WAI-ARIA compliant React autocomplete, combobox or select dropdown components.β12,299Updated this week
- β‘οΈFaster subsequent page-loads by prefetching in-viewport links during idle timeβ11,231Mar 10, 2026Updated last week
- Transform SVGs into React components π¦β11,023Mar 1, 2026Updated 3 weeks ago
- The Axios API, as an 800 byte Fetch wrapper.β4,881Aug 15, 2023Updated 2 years ago
- A JavaScript bundle optimizer.β14,135Feb 11, 2022Updated 4 years ago
- Create the next immutable state by mutating the current oneβ28,910Mar 6, 2026Updated 2 weeks ago
- The zero configuration build tool for the web. π¦πβ44,046Mar 15, 2026Updated last week
- Function argument validation for humansβ3,876Oct 16, 2025Updated 5 months ago